Lottery Ticket Worth Over $1.4 Million Sold in Westmoreland County

Middletown, PA — A jackpot-winning Pennsylvania Lottery Cash 5 with Quick Cash ticket worth $1,420,857 was sold in Westmoreland County for the Sunday, June 9 drawing.

The winning ticket, which matched all five numbers drawn (2-3-19-27-42), was sold at Giant Eagle, located at 200 Tarentum Bridge Road in New Kensington.

The retailer will receive a $10,000 bonus for selling the winning ticket.

Winners can only be identified after prizes are claimed and tickets validated. Main Cash 5 game prizes must be claimed within one year of the drawing date, and Quick Cash game prizes within one year of purchase. Jackpot-winning ticket holders should contact the nearest Lottery office or call 1-800-692-7481 for further instructions.

Additionally, more than 30,200 other Cash 5 with Quick Cash tickets won prizes in the drawing. Players are encouraged to check every ticket and claim lower-tier prizes at a Lottery retailer.
